Market Overview:
The global natural food and beverage preservatives market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 6.5% during the forecast period from 2018 to 2030. The growth in this market can be attributed to the increasing demand for healthy and organic food products, which has led to an increase in the use of natural food preservatives. In addition, the stringent regulations on synthetic preservatives are also driving the growth of this market. Product Definition:
There is no single definition of a natural food and beverage preservative. Generally, they are considered to be substances that occur naturally in foods and beverages, or that are produced through biotechnology, and that are used to protect against spoilage and contamination. Natural food and beverage preservatives may include acids (such as acetic acid or lactic acid), herbs (such as rosemary or thyme), enzymes (such as pectinase), fermentation products (such as vinegar or probiotics), minerals (such as salt or potassium sorbate), essential oils (including tea tree oil, clove oil, cinnamon oil, lemon balm oil) and other plant extracts.

Application Insights:
Dairy products were the largest application segment and accounted for a revenue share of more than 40.0% in 2017. The growth is attributed to the increasing consumption of dairy products, especially among the aging population across countries such as Germany, Japan, China and India. Moreover, demand for low-fat milk alternatives such as skimmed milk powder is also driving market growth in this segment.
The beverages application segment was valued at USD 478.1 million in 2017 owing to rising demand for juices from various fruits including apple, orange and grape among others coupled with growing use of natural preservatives in beverages such as wine.
Regional Analysis:
North America accounted for the largest share of over 35.0% in 2017. The region is expected to maintain its dominance throughout the forecast period owing to high consumer awareness regarding a healthy diet and growing demand for preservatives with reduced calorie level, low sugar content, and high nutritional value. Europe was the second-largest market in 2017 and is anticipated to witness steady growth over the forecast period owing to stringent regulations about use of synthetic chemicals as food additives coupled with rising consumer preference toward natural products.
Growth Factors:
- Increasing demand for natural and organic food products: The global market for natural and organic food is projected to grow at a CAGR of more than 14% from 2016 to 2021. This growth is driven by the increasing awareness among consumers about the health benefits of consuming natural and organic foods.
- Rising demand for convenience foods: The growing trend of busy lifestyles has led to an increase in the demand for convenience foods, which are easy to prepare and consume on the go. Natural food preservatives offer several advantages over synthetic preservatives, such as improved flavor profile, longer shelf life, etc., which is driving their adoption in the convenience food segment.
- Growing popularity of processed meat products: Processed meat products are gaining popularity due to their extended shelf life and enhanced flavor profile as compared to fresh meat products. Natural food preservatives are being increasingly used in processed meat products as they do not impart any unpleasant flavors or odors into these products like synthetic preservatives can sometimes do.
